Schuylkill Haven, PA| The Rosemont Ravens Traveled to Penn State Schuylkill, The Contest Was Played at Schuylkill Haven High School.
How it Happened:
Emily Rossino would start between the posts for the Ravens, as they would et an early jump in the game putting the pressure on the Nittany Lions. A barrage of shots by multiple Ravens before
Rena Kotsedakis would find the Ravens first goal giving the girls a 1-0 advantage late in the 11'.
Anna Nicosia would score her first Collegiate goal 50 second later in the match to give the Ravens an early 2-0 advantage. The Ravens would continue to hold the offensive advantage as shots by Erin Mclaughlin and
Kassidy Phillips were saved.
Sarah Warner would find the back of the net off an assist from Erin Mclaughlin to give the Ravens a 3-0 advantage in the 26'. A foul by Rosemont would set up a goal for the Nittany Lions as the half would end 3-1.Â
As the second half started Rosemont would continue to pressure the Nittany Lions defense shots by Erin Mcalughlin
Cassidy Smith saved by the keeper.
Sarah Warner would finder her second goal of the game to give the Ravens a 4-1 Lead in the 62' The Ravens defense would continue to keep the ball on the other side of the field setting up multiple shot opportunities for the Ravens.
Rena Kotsedakis would have two goals and six shots in the match along with
Sarah Warner with two goals and five shots of her own. Erin Mclaughlin,
Kassidy Phillips and
Cassidy Smith would all have four shots in the contest as
Amanda Ritter (GK) and
Brianna Samson would hold the lions to zero in the second half. The Ravens win 4-1!
